The flavor is where it really comes alive. Swapping tequila for mezcal gives the drink a deep, smoky edge that stands up beautifully to all that spice. Fresh lime keeps everything tart and lively, honey syrup brings a smooth, mellow sweetness, and a generous splash of Cholula runs a tangy, savory heat right through the middle. I double the hot sauce here, because mezcal's bold flavor can more than handle the extra kick. You get smoky and spicy, sweet and bright, all in one lively glass.

And it could not be simpler to make. A quick shake, a pour over a big ice cube, and a garnish of cayenne and a spicy red pepper, and your mezcal torchlight is ready to sip.

Smoky Mezcal Torchlight Cocktail

A smoky mezcal torchlight made with mezcal, honey syrup, fresh lime, and a double splash of Cholula. Garnish with cayenne and a spicy red pepper for extra heat.

Prep Time 5 minutes
Total Time 5 minutes
Servings: 1 cocktail
Course: Cocktail

Ingredients  

  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1 tablespoon hot water
  • 2 ounces mezcal
  • 1 ounce lime juice
  • 12 dashes Cholula sauce see notes
  • Cayenne pepper and fresh chili pepper to garnish

Method
 

  1. Make the honey syrup by mixing honey and hot tap water in a small dish or glass.
    1 tablespoon honey, 1 tablespoon hot water

  2. Add the mezcal, lime juice, Cholula sauce, honey syrup, and ice to a cocktail shaker, then shake until cold.
    2 ounces mezcal, 1 ounce lime juice, 12 dashes Cholula sauce

  3. Pour into a rocks glass with a large ice cube, then garnish with a sprinkle of cayenne pepper and a fresh chili pepper.
    Cayenne pepper and fresh chili pepper

Notes

If you're not sure you're up for the heat, start with less Cholula sauce, shake, taste, and add more if you'd like.
